Understanding Legal Legal Right



Comprehending your lawful rights is important when navigating the intricacies of the legal system. Recognizing what you're entitled to under the law can considerably influence the result of your instance. You're not just a spectator in your lawful fights; you're an energetic individual with rights that secure you.

Firstly, you deserve to stay silent. This isn't simply a line in motion pictures; it's your guard against self-incrimination. Whatever you claim can certainly be made use of versus you, so recognizing the power of silence is critical.

You also deserve to be stood for by an attorney. Whether you work with one or have actually one appointed, lawful representation is your basic right. It guarantees you have a specialist to navigate the legal details and supporter in your place.

Additionally, you're entitled to a fair trial. This indicates being attempted in a competent court, by an unbiased jury, and without undue hold-up. You additionally have the right to challenge witnesses versus you, which permits your protection to cross-examine the prosecution's witnesses and challenge their testament.

Identifying these rights encourages you to take an energetic role in your defense and assists guard your liberty and future.

Approaches in Defense



Why should you recognize the most effective defense methods? As you browse the complexities of a criminal situation, understanding various defense strategies can substantially influence the result. Your lawyer's technique to your defense could differ based upon the evidence, the nature of the charges, and local legislations. Below's what you need to find out about crafting the protection strategy.

First of all, determining inconsistencies or errors in the prosecution's evidence is vital. Your lawyer will look at every detail, looking for spaces that can be manipulated to your advantage. They could additionally challenge the admissibility of evidence if it was poorly gotten, thus damaging the prosecution's instance.



Second of all, think about the alibi defense. This involves celebration legitimate witnesses or tangible evidence to sustain your case of being somewhere else.

Furthermore, protection is one more strategy, applicable if you're implicated of a fierce criminal offense and you think you were protecting on your own. Showing that you would certainly a reasonable belief of impending harm and that your action was proportionate can be reliable.

Each technique calls for thorough preparation and a deep understanding of legal precedents and civil liberties. Your attorney's function is to customize these techniques to fit the specifics of your instance, aiming for the very best possible outcome.

Test Prep Work and Depiction



After discovering defense methods, it is necessary to concentrate on just how your lawyer will certainly plan for trial and represent you in court. Your legal representative's role changes dramatically as they move from preparing to activity.

Initially, they'll gather and analyze all proof, guaranteeing they recognize the case from top to bottom. This consists of depositions, witness statements, and any type of physical evidence that might impact your test.

Next off, your attorney will certainly establish a compelling narrative. They'll craft a tale that aligns with the evidence however likewise humanizes you to the court. This narrative is vital; it's the foundation of your defense, developed to resonate with jurors' feelings and logic.

Mock tests could be performed to improve arguments and prepare for prosecution strategies. Your lawyer will additionally make a decision whether you ought to testify, which can be a pivotal decision in your instance.

Throughout the actual trial, anticipate your lawyer to be assertive. They'll test disparities in the prosecution's proof and cross-examine witnesses to highlight uncertainties concerning their dependability or credibility.
